Claudia Taylor Johnson 1912 – 2007
Claudia was born in Carnac Texas in 1912. She was one of the last, if not the last true genteel southern ladies. She was an environmentalist before that word entered the lexicon. Though I didn’t think much of her husband she was always interested in both the children of the country as well as the environment. Far from being a radical she worked well into this decade to fight illiteracy and to help keep a lot of Texas range land just that. She was given the nickname Lady Bird in her youth. It is said she hated it.
